Site hosted by Angelfire.com: Build your free website today!
eMule Mod Feature List!                                                            
                                                             
Requirements to have Mod on Review List:                                                            
1.  Must publish the source code                                                            
2.  Must have Manual SLS                                                            
3.  Must have Kick (Remove from Upload!)                                                            
That's it!  :)                                                            
                                                             
Updated: January 10th, 2005 - 10:00pm PDT                                                            
                                                             
Release Date 1/10/2005 10/28/2004 9/15/2004 9/11/2004 5/29/2004 5/17/2004 Release Date 10/28/2004 10/19/2004 9/9/2004 10/5/2004 10/1/2004                                    
Status Release Release Test Release Test Release Release Release Status Release Release Release Release Release                                    
Name Iberica Iberica IbericaXT IbericaXT IbericaXT IbericaXT Name Iberica Iberica NextEvolution LSD LSD                                    
Version 19k 18z 4c 4b 3d 3b Version 18z 18x 2.2c 18b.1014 18b Final                                    
Base Code 0.44d/LSD19b 0.44b/Paw5.15f ZZUL 0.44a ZZUL 0.44a ZZUL 0.42g ZZUL 0.42g Base Code 0.44b/Paw5.15f 0.44b/LSD18b Official 0.44a Pawcio 5.14/0.44b Pawcio 5.13/0.44b                                    
Thanks to! Spanish Man Spanish Man BCNL BCNL BCNL BCNL Thanks to! Spanish Man Spanish Man KTS drLSD drLSD                                    
                                                             
Download Screen Features             Download Screen Features                                              
Manual Save/Load Sources Yes Yes No Yes Yes Yes Manual Save/Load Sources Yes Yes No Yes Yes                                    
Reask Server Yes Yes Yes No Yes Yes Reask Server Yes Yes No Yes Yes                                    
Reask Client Yes No Yes Yes Yes Yes Reask Client (only for clients where you're not on Queue) No No Yes No No                                    
Drop Client Yes Yes Yes Yes Yes Yes Drop Client Yes Yes Yes Yes Yes                                    
Show Banned Client beside QR No No Yes No No No Show Banned Client beside QR No No No No No                                    
Download Left Chunks/Right/InBlock Yes Yes No No No No Download Left Chunks/Right/InBlock Yes Yes No No No                                    
BG Video Preview Download Left to Right Yes                                                          
ICS or Default Chunk Selection Yes Yes No No No No ICS or Default Chunk Selection Yes Yes No No No                                    
                                                             
                                                             
Upload Screen Features             Upload Screen Features                                              
Remove from Upload Yes Yes Yes Yes Yes Yes Remove from Upload Yes Yes Yes Yes Yes                                    
Push to Upload from Queue (Only use on HighID Peers) Yes No Yes Yes Yes Yes Push to Upload from Queue (Only use on HighID Peers) No No Yes No No                                    
Ban User 24h (invoked from Uploads) Yes No Yes Yes No Yes Ban User 24h (invoked from Uploads) No No No No No                                    
Ban User 24h (invoked from Queue) Yes No No No No Yes Ban User 24h (invoked from Queue) No No No No No                                    
Trickle Slots Yes Yes Yes Yes Yes Yes Trickle Slots Yes Yes Yes Yes Yes                                    
Slot Focus Yes Yes Yes Yes Yes Yes Slot Focus Yes Yes Yes Yes Yes                                    
Download Status column/colors Yes No Yes No No No Download Status column No No No No No                                    
Open File from Upload and Queue Yes Yes No No No No Open File from Upload and Queue Yes Yes No Yes Yes                                    
Transferring (All Downloading) Clients View Yes Yes No No No No Transferring (All Downloading) Clients View Yes Yes No Yes Yes                                    
                                                             
                                                             
Shared Files Screen Features             Shared Files Screen Features                                              
Powershare Yes Yes Yes Yes Yes Yes Powershare Yes Yes Yes Yes Yes                                    
Un-Share Downloaded File (unless Shared/Reload) No No No No No No Un-Share Downloaded File (unless Shared/Reload) No No No No No                                    
Comment Icons Yes Yes No No Yes Yes Comment Icons Yes No No No No                                    
                                                             
                                                             
Global Preferences and Tweaks             Global Preferences and Tweaks                                              
Download Features             Download Features                                              
Save/Load Sources Configurable Number to Save Yes Yes Yes Yes Yes Yes Save/Load Sources Configurable Number to Save Yes Yes Yes Yes Yes                                    
Save/Load Sources Configurable every x Minutes No No No Yes No No Save/Load Sources Configurable every x Minutes No No No No No                                    
                                                             
Upload Features             Upload Features                                              
Pawcio Credit System Yes Yes Yes Yes No No Pawcio Credit System Yes Yes Yes Yes Yes                                    
Lovelace/Eastshare Credit Systems Yes Yes Yes Yes No No Lovelace/Eastshare Credit Systems Yes Yes Yes No No                                    
Ratio Credit System (from Eastshare) Yes Yes Yes Yes No No Ratio Credit System (from Eastshare) Yes Yes No No No                                    
BillyGates Credit System Yes Yes No No No No BillyGates Credit System Yes Yes No No No                                    
Block Last Chunk Yes No No No No No Block Last Chunk No No No No No                                    
Anti-Leecher Upload Ratio Kick 1:X Yes No No No No No Anti-Leecher Upload Ratio Kick 1:X No No No No No                                    
Anti-Leecher Auto Upload Kick Yes No No No No No Anti-Leecher Auto Upload Kick No No No No No                                    
Configurable Client Ban Time No No No No No No Configurable Client Ban Time No No No No No                                    
Pay Back First No No No No No No Pay Back First No No No No No                                    
                                                             
Security Features             Security Features                                              
Anonymous Mod Yes Yes No No Yes No Anonymous Mod Yes Yes No Yes Yes                                    
Invisible Mode (Configurable Hotkey to Enable) Yes Yes No No No No Invisible Mode (Configurable Hotkey to Enable) Yes Yes No No No                                    
                                                             
Miscellaneous Features             Miscellaneous Features                                              
Show your own Userhash Yes Yes Yes Yes Yes Yes Show your own Userhash Yes Yes Yes No No                                    
Country Flags Yes Yes Yes Yes Yes Yes Country Flags Yes No Yes No No                                    
Show peer IP address in Client Details Yes Yes Yes Yes Yes Yes Show peer IP address in Client Details Yes Yes No No No                                    
Copy IP Address out of Client Details No No Yes Yes No No Copy IP Address out of Client Details No No No No No                                    
Away State (Auto-msg reply when manually set 'away') Yes Yes Yes Yes Yes Yes Away State (Auto-msg reply when manually set 'away') Yes Yes Yes No No                                    
Option to block sharing with non-eMule clients  Yes Yes Yes No No No Option to block sharing with non-eMule clients  Yes Yes No No No                                    
Option to block publishing files(can't be found searching) No No No No No No Option to block publishing files(can't be found searching) No No No No No                                    
Option to Full Share/Download Share/No Share No No No No No No Option to Full Share/Download Share/No Share No No No No No                                    
Webcache Yes Yes No No No No Webcache Yes Yes No Yes Yes                                    
Show Kad Buddy IP :) No No No No No No Show Kad Buddy IP :) No No No No No                                    
WhoIs Query - DNS Information Yes Yes No No No No WhoIs Query - DNS Information Yes Yes No No No                                    
Manual Ban Message Customizable :) No No No No No No Manual Ban Message Customizable :) No No No No No                                    
Auto-re-ask after download of chunk finished :) No No No No No No Auto-re-ask after download of chunk finished :) No No No No No                                    
Option to Kick & Ban with customizable message sent No No No No No No Option to Kick & Ban with customizable message sent No No No No No                                    
FastFinish code dropping slow clients with <2MB to go No No No No No No FastFinish code dropping slow clients with <2MB to go No No No No No                                    
Auto-re-ask after download of chunk finished :) No No No No No No Auto-re-ask after download of chunk finished :) No No No No No                                    
Official Credit System:
There are two different credit modifier calculated: 
Ratio1 = Uploaded Total x 2 / Downloaded Total 
Ratio2 = SQRT(Uploaded Total + 2) 
Both ratios are compared and the lower value is used as modifier. 
Some boundary conditions also exist: 
> Uploaded Total < 1MB => Modifier = 1 
> Downloaded Total = 0 => Modifier = 10 
> The modifier may not be lower than 1 or higher than 10 
Lovelace Credit System:
l-modifier=100*((1-1/(1+exp((3*{MB uploaded to us}^2-{MB downloaded from us}^2)/1000)))^6.6667) 
new credit system (start:1, max:100, min:0.1, ratio:1:1.5, only one formula) 
CreditThefts will not get any credits. Only clients using the 'SecureHash' are able to get a multiplier of 100. All others will stick at 10. 
In contrast to the original credit system, credits are evaluated more on differences and not on quotients. Using the orginal system you have the best 
credit values shortly after generating a new userhash. With the new credit system you get good credit values faster if you already have uploaded
many MB before (and did not cheat by killing the userhash). 
(old system: 5up/ 5down = DLModifier of 2, additional 5up = DLModifier of 4 
10up/10down = DLModifier of 2, additional 5up = DLModifier of 3 
-> for the same amount of additional upload you get less score (-25%) 
new system: 5up/ 5down = DLModifier of 1.16, additional 5up = DLModifier of 2.31 
10up/10down = DLModifier of 1.85, additional 5up = DLModifier of 5.09 
-> for the same amount of additional upload you get more score (+120%) 
because you already uploaded a certain amount before.) 
Pawcio Credit System:
- Range from 1.0 to 100.0 
- Multiplier of 3 (instead of 2) ---- ratio = 3 * downloaded / uploaded 
- For new clients (downloaded and uploaded data less than 1MB) ratio = 3.0 (instead of 1.0) 
- If you have recieved more than 1MB from someone but haven't given anything back user gets ratio = 100.0 
- Small bonus for clients that have given you many MB: 
- if you get 100MB then user recieve ratio = 50.0 till you give back 108MB 
- 50MB - ratio = 25.0 - 55MB 
- 25MB - ratio = 12.0 - 28MB 
- 10MB - ratio = 5.0 - 12MB 
Eastshare Credit System:
Base ratings: id. users(100); not supported users(80); invalid id. users(0); min.=10, max.=5000
  +6 per MB uploaded and -2 for downloaded; +100 if upload 1MB+; if rating < 50 and upload 1MB+, rating = 50
BillyGates Credit System:
Eastshare with +1000 ratings boost to new clients that have downloaded less than 1MB from you.
Ratio Credit System:
* based on official cs, but lowest modifier's 0.1 not 1.0 in official 
* x2, x4, x16 credit award to uploaders 
Pay Back First:
If upload from peer > download from peer and peer on queue, immediately gets pushed to Upload
Reverse/Dazzle Credits:
- Give a 10x score increase to clients in your download queue (you will be wanting something from them soon) 
- penalize NoNeededParts and queuefull 2x (currently they're not needed but they might be in future, upload to them when all other sources have a score of at least 5) 
- Give a slight score increase if the estimated waiting time in their queue is low (this will be implemented in the next version)
- Give a slight score increase (smallest) for waiting time, just to be fair.
In effect, the our client will be serving other clients in this order: 
- clients we try to download from who we haven't uploaded to anything yet (they'll get 1.1mb for the max ratio), clients with low estimated waiting time for their queue will go first 
- Clients who have returned upload and we are trying to download from up to a ratio of 5x 
- Clients we're trying to download from but are on NNP or queue full status get 1.1mb 
- All other clients we're trying to download from are served upload up to a ratio of 10x 
- All clients that are not in our downloading queue are server their initial 1.1mb (this is done because we might want something from them in the future) 
- All clients that have returned upload to us at one time, but currently we do not want anything in return, up to a ratio of 10. 
- All clients who have a maximum rating will be served on a first come first served basis